Basic facts about this digital color

#B9D770 falls into the Chartreuse Color Family — Moderate Saturation, Very Light brightness. The mix behind it: rgb(185, 215, 112) — 72.5% red, 84.3% green, 43.9% blue; the print equivalent is CMYK 12 / 0 / 40 / 16. New to color codes? See our guide to RGB color codes.

A confidently colored zesty chartreuse, #B9D770 floats near the light end of the scale. Designers typically reach for tones like this for airy backdrops, whitespace-heavy designs and gentle gradients. In The Official Register of Color Names it is just a few steps away from Pale Olive Green (#B1D27B). Nearby in the Register you will also find Greenish Tan (#BCCB7A) and Poprock (#C0C975).

In RGB terms — rgb(185, 215, 112) — the green channel does the heavy lifting here. On this background, black text reaches a 13.0:1 contrast ratio (passing WCAG AAA); white stays at 1.6:1. No one has named #B9D770 so far. Register a name for it and it becomes a permanent record.

#B9D770 color harmonies

Color harmonies are pleasing color schemes created according to their position on a color wheel.

Complementary

Complementary color schemes are made by picking two opposite colors con the color wheel. They appear vibrant near to each other.

Complementary color schemes

Split complementary

Split complementary schemes are like complementary but they uses two adiacent colors of the complement. They are more flexible than complementary ones.

Split complementary color scheme

Analogous

Analogous color schemes are made by picking three colors that are next to each other on the color wheel. They are perceived as calm and serene.

Analogous color scheme

Triadic

Triadic color schemes are created by picking three colors equally spaced on the color wheel. They appear quite contrasted and multicolored.

Triadic color scheme

Tetradic

Tetradic color schemes are made form two couples of complementary colors in a rectangular shape on the color wheel.

Tetradic color scheme

Square

Square color schemes are like tetradic arranged in a square instead of rectangle. Colors appear even more contrasting.
